The federal government developed the Employee Retention Credit (ERC) to offer a refundable employment tax credit to help organizations with the expense of keeping team employed.
Eligible companies that experienced a decline in gross receipts or were shut due to government order and also really did not claim the credit when they filed their original return can take advantage by submitting modified employment tax returns. For instance, services that submit quarterly employment tax returns can submit Form 941 X,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return or Claim for RefundPDF, to claim the credit for previous 2020 and also 2021 quarters. ERC guidance IRS.
With the exception of a recoverystartup business, most taxpayers came to be disqualified to claim the ERC for incomes paid after September 30, 2021. ERC guidance IRS. A recovery start-up business can still claim the ERC for incomes paid after June 30, 2021, as well as prior to January 1, 2022. Eligible employers may still claim the ERC for prior quarters by submitting an relevant adjusted employment income tax return within the due date stated in the equivalent form instructions. ERC guidance IRS. If an company files a Form 941, the company still has time to file an adjusted return within the time set forth under the “Is There a Deadline for Filing Form 941-X?” area in Form 941-X,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return or Claim for Refund.
What Is The Employee Retention Credit (ERC), And How Does The Program Work?
When the Covid 19 pandemic began, as well as businesses were forced to shut down their operations, Congress passed programs to supply financial aid to firms. Among these programs was the staff member retention credit ( ERC).
The ERC provides qualified companies payroll tax credit scores for incomes and medical insurance paid to employees. When the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act was signed right into regulation in November 2021, it placed an end to the ERC program.
In spite of completion of the program, services still have the opportunity to insurance claim ERC for approximately 3 years retroactively. ERC guidance IRS. Right here is an introduction of exactly how the program jobs and how to claim this credit for your business.
What Is The ERC?
Originally offered from March 13, 2020, through December 31, 2020, the ERC is a refundable pay-roll tax credit developed as part of the CARAR 0.0% ES Act. ERC guidance IRS. The purpose of the ERC was to motivate employers to maintain their staff members on payroll during the pandemic.
Qualifying companies as well as customers that obtained a Paycheck Protection Program loan can claim approximately 50% of qualified earnings, including qualified medical insurance expenditures. The Consolidated Appropriations Act (CAA) expanded the ERC. Companies that qualified in 2021 can claim a credit of 70% in qualified wages.

What Are Qualified Wages?
What counts as qualified salaries depends upon the size of your business and also the number of employees you have on team. There’s no size restriction to be qualified for the ERC, but tiny as well as huge business are treated differently.
For 2020, if you had greater than 100 permanent staff members in 2019, you can only claim the earnings of workers you retained but were not working. If you have less than 100 staff members, you can claim everyone, whether they were working or otherwise.
For 2021, the limit was raised to having 500 permanent staff members in 2019, offering employers a lot a lot more leeway as to that they can claim for the credit. ERC guidance IRS. Any salaries that are subject to FICA taxes Qualify, and also you can consist of qualified health expenditures when calculating the tax credit.
This income needs to have been paid between March 13, 2020, as well as September 30, 2021. recovery start-up companies have to claim the credit via the end of 2021.
